Asha Bhosle, one of the most iconic playback singers who has contributed to Indian cinema for nearly eight decades, became the target of death hoax. Recently, news about the death of a 91-year-old legend surfaced on Facebook by a user, Shabana Shaikh. While some fans were too quick to mourn the loss, her son, Anad Bhosle, reacted to the news and called it fake.

A Facebook user named Shabana Shaikh shared a photo of singer Asha Bhosle with a garland of flowers placed on it with a caption: “Famous singer Asha Bhosle passed away – a musical era ends (01 July 2025).” At the same time, another post made a similar claim and wrote – “Ham ne ek aor anmol kalakaar kho diye.”

Earlier in June 2025, Asha Bhosle graced the special screening of Umrao Jaan starring iconic Rekha. The movie has been re-released after more than four decades, and Bhosle had shared the stage with Rekha and director Muzaffar Ali during her performance.

Asha Bhosle is the sister of the late legendary playback singer Lata Mangeshkar. Bhosle was married to the late music director, singer Rahul Dev Burman. She is best known for singing tracks like O Haseena Zulfonwali Jane Jahan, Hungama Ho Gaya, Chura Liya Hai Tumne Jo Dil Ko, Mera Kuchh Saamaan, O Mere Sona Re, and many more.
